In Burning Bright River and Flynn's romance is still going strong. River thinks Flynn has his anger under control, but when she discovers he has been getting into fights and is facing a terrible accusation at school, she starts to question both Flynn's honesty - and the intensity of their passion. Things come to a head at a family get together when River sees Flynn fly into one unprovoked rage too many. The consequences for both of them are devastating and threaten to tear them apart forever.

But now  in Casting Shadows, Flynn is making every effort to stay in control of his hot temper, while River feels more content than she's ever been. Together the two of them make big plans for the future, but powerful secrets lurk in the shadows, ready to threaten their happiness.

The Review: Sophie McKenzie is back with the third instalment to her Flynn series and wow, what a ride Casting Shadows is. 

Casting Shadows brings us happiness, teenage drama and unfortunately, some unhappy times. Flynn's trying his hardest be the person he needs to be for River, however when it feels like the rest of the world is against Flynn, it's only so long before things come to ahead. 

I was really excited to start Casting Shadows and I'm glad it lived up to my expectations. Sophie McKenzie really up'd the ant with this book and just when you thought things couldn't get worse - they do. I loved that while reading this I was full of suspense. I wasn't sure what was coming but when it did, it was so emotional! 

River and Flynn's relationship this time around grows a lot. As their growing up, they're becoming more mature and they try to tackle their day to day problems better than have been. When things are good between them, they are the perfect couple. They love each other so much and it's really cute to read about them during their happy times.

I'm excited to see what Sophie brings us with the final book - these two characters must get a happy ending but more importantly, they need to somehow over come their issues for that to happen. Either way, I can't wait to see the end of their story.


Sophie McKenzieAbout Author: 
Sophie was born and brought up in London, where she still lives. She has worked as a journalist and a magazine editor, but fell in love with writing after being made redundant and enrolling in a creative writing course. She burst into the publishing world with Girl, Missing her debut novel (published 2006), which tallied up numerous award wins nationwide, including the Richard and Judy Best Kids’ Books 2007 (12+ category), The Red House Book Award and The Manchester Children’s Book Award. She was also longlisted for the Branford Boase award, which commends debut authors, and the coveted Carnegie Medal. Girl, Missing was followed by two other books in the Missing series: Sister, Missing and Missing Me. Plus other thrillers (the Blood Ties and The Medusa Project series), the Luke and Eve romance books and Sophie's latest romance series which includes Falling Fast, Burning Bright, Casting Shadows and Defy the Stars.
